DIMM Installation

Use the following procedure to install a DIMM.
1. Remove the access cover.
2. Locate the DIMM sockets.
3. Remove any currently-installed DIMMs that are not needed. See the
previous section "DIMM Removal."
Before installing a DIMM, reduce static discharge by
touching the system's metal chassis.
4. To install a DIMM, align the module with an empty socket. Make sure that
the notches on the DIMM line up with the keys in the sockets.
5. Insert the DIMM into the socket. Close the plastic clips at both ends of the
socket.
6. Replace any cables or boards that may have been removed.
7. Replace the access cover.
